我正在使用 Apache Hadoop 3.3.6。
我在 hdfs-site.xml 中进行了设置:
<property>
<name>dfs.namenode.secondary.https-address</name>
<value>192.168.56.193:9869</value>
</property>
但是启动时,我的辅助名称节点以与名称节点相同的IP(192.168.56.213)启动。我该如何解决它?
我尝试在互联网上搜索但无法收到任何满意的答案。
通过 SSH 连接到该服务器并显式启动辅助名称节点
$ ssh 192.168.56.193
$ $HADOOP_HOME/sbin/hadoop-daemon.sh start secondarynamenode
您可以通过检查 Hadoop 日志或运行以下命令来验证辅助 Namenode 是否正在运行:
$ $HADOOP_HOME/bin/hdfs dfsadmin -report